content_edit page is blank

Hello,

For one of out sites we recently noticed that the content_edit section of the site is now showing up blank:

i.e. /admin.php?/cp/content_edit&channel_id=9&S=0341….

It is completely blank with no errors in the browser console, and when inspected nothing is rendering in the html body.

The rest of the CMS seems to be working fine.

We are using v2.9.0 Debug Preference is set to - 0: No PHP/SQL error messages generated Display Template Debugging is set to - No

Would setting Debug Preference to 1 only show front end errors or will that help with CMS errors as well?

Are there any error logs where this issue might be reporting on the server?

Thanks

Hi Hector. Yes the errors may be showing up in your PHP error log, worth looking in there. I would also try opening up your admin.php file and searching for $debug = 0; and change it to $debug = 1;, it’s a little different than the control panel debug setting. Also please try to upgrade ExpressionEngine.
